概括
肺结核 (TB) 治疗中使用pyrazinamide (PZA) 治疗超尿血是常见的,但这项研究发现它没有增加主要不良心血管事件 (MACE). 事实上,结核病治疗期间的高尿血与更好的患者结局有关.

背景情况:
- 结核病 (TB) 治疗期间经常发生超尿血,特别是在使用皮拉津胺 (PZA) 时.
- 结核病患者的高尿血和主要不良心血管事件 (MACE) 之间的关联需要进一步调查.
研究的目的:
- 调查结核病治疗患者中高尿血和MACE发病率之间的关系.
- 探索超尿血症在结核病治疗期间对患者结果的影响.
主要方法:
- 进行了一项单一中心回顾性队列研究,涉及1143名在2010年1月至2017年6月期间接受治疗的结核病患者.
- 超尿血症被定义为血清尿酸水平>7.0毫克/分升男性和>6.0毫克/分升女性.
- 使用后勤回归分析来评估高尿血,MACE和死亡率之间的关联.
主要成果:
- 在82.3%的患者中检测到高尿路血,其中94.6%接受PZA.
- 以前的缺血性心脏病与MACE的发展有显著的关联 (OR, 14.087),而高尿路血症没有 (OR, 1.505).
- 对于没有耐药结核病的患者,高尿血与较低的死亡率 (OR,0.316) 和更好的结局有关.
结论:
- 尽管在使用PZA治疗结核病期间存在高尿路血,但它与MACEs的风险增加无关.
- 结核病治疗期间的高尿路血可能与改善患者的治疗结果有关,这可能反映出更好的治疗坚持.

Tuberculosis, often called TB, is a contagious illness primarily caused by Mycobacterium tuberculosis. It mainly affects the lung parenchyma but can also impact other body parts.
Causative Organism
The primary infectious agent causing tuberculosis is Mycobacterium tuberculosis, a slow-growing, acid-fast, aerobic rod that exhibits sensitivity to heat and ultraviolet light. Instances of Mycobacterium bovis and Mycobacterium avium contributing to the development of TB infection are rare.
